If 60.0 mL60.0~\mathrm{mL} of water were added to 80.0 mL80.0~\mathrm{mL} of a 0.500M0.500\mathrm{M} sodium carbonate, Na2CO3, solution, what would the final molarity be? (Hint – what is the total new volume?)

Answer


C1V1=C2V2Vfinal=80+60=140 mL0.5M80 mL=Cx140 mLCx=0.580140=0.286M\begin{array}{l} C_{1} \cdot V_{1} = C_{2} \cdot V_{2} \\ V_{\text{final}} = 80 + 60 = 140~\mathrm{mL} \\ 0.5\,M \cdot 80~\mathrm{mL} = C_{x} \cdot 140~\mathrm{mL} \\ C_{x} = \frac{0.5 \cdot 80}{140} = 0.286\,M \\ \end{array}


Answer: [Na2CO3]=0.286M;V=140 mL[Na_2CO_3] = 0.286\,M; V = 140~\mathrm{mL}
